Webber criticizes Ferrari fans for jeering Vettel

After winning the first Italian Grand Prix podium place of his career in his last European race, Mark Webber took a parting shot at Ferrari fans for jeering race winner and Red Bull teammate Sebastian Vettel. The 37-year-old Webber, who finished third behind Ferrari's Fernando Alonso, is retiring from Formula 1 at the end of the season to race for German manufacturer Porsche. Given his often tense relationship with Vettel at Red Bull over the years, this was a rare show of support as he criticized the Ferrari 'tifosi' who booed loudly when Vettel made his podium speech.
